Urban Food Security: where should wholesale markets be located?
Markets have been, since their creation, the epicenter of city life. They are places where goods are exchanged, where people meet, but above all, they are the places that make food security possible in our cities. Markets, as we know them today, date back to the 19th century. How to measure urban poverty?: a multidimensional approach for segregated cities
For decades, the eradication of poverty has been the goal of Latin American and Caribbean countries. Even so, 32.1% of the population has an income below the poverty line and 13.1% below the indigence line. Measuring poverty is vital to eradicate it.
